实现网络监控需要哪些工具?

随着互联网的快速发展,网络安全问题日益突出,网络监控成为了企业、组织和个人保护信息安全的重要手段。为了实现网络监控,需要借助一系列专业的工具。本文将详细介绍实现网络监控所需的主要工具,帮助您更好地了解并选择合适的监控工具。

一、网络流量监控工具

网络流量监控是网络监控的基础,以下是一些常用的网络流量监控工具:

  1. Wireshark:Wireshark是一款开源的网络协议分析工具,可以捕获和分析网络数据包,帮助用户了解网络流量情况。

  2. Nagios:Nagios是一款开源的网络监控软件,可以监控网络设备、服务器、应用程序等,提供实时监控和报警功能。

  3. Zabbix:Zabbix是一款开源的监控解决方案,支持多种监控方式,包括网络流量监控、服务器性能监控等。

二、入侵检测与防御工具

入侵检测与防御是网络安全的重要组成部分,以下是一些常用的入侵检测与防御工具:

  1. Snort:Snort是一款开源的入侵检测系统,可以检测和阻止各种网络攻击。

  2. Suricata:Suricata是一款高性能的入侵检测和防御系统,支持多种检测模式,如IDS、IPS和NIDS。

  3. ClamAV:ClamAV是一款开源的病毒扫描工具,可以扫描电子邮件、文件和磁盘等,防止病毒入侵。

三、日志分析工具

日志分析是网络监控的重要环节,以下是一些常用的日志分析工具:

  1. ELK Stack:ELK Stack是由Elasticsearch、Logstash和Kibana组成的日志分析平台,可以高效地收集、存储和分析日志数据。

  2. Splunk:Splunk是一款商业日志分析平台,可以处理大量日志数据,提供实时监控和可视化分析。

四、网络性能监控工具

网络性能监控是保证网络正常运行的关键,以下是一些常用的网络性能监控工具:

  1. iperf:iperf是一款网络性能测试工具,可以测试网络带宽、延迟和丢包率等性能指标。

  2. Metrictank:Metrictank是一款开源的监控数据存储工具,可以存储大量的监控数据,支持多种监控指标。

五、案例分析

以某企业为例,该企业采用以下工具实现网络监控:

  1. 使用Wireshark和Nagios进行网络流量监控,实时了解网络状况。

  2. 使用Snort和Suricata进行入侵检测与防御,有效防止网络攻击。

  3. 使用ELK Stack进行日志分析,及时发现异常情况。

  4. 使用iperf和Metrictank进行网络性能监控,保证网络正常运行。

通过以上工具的配合使用,该企业实现了全面的网络监控,有效提高了网络安全防护能力。

总之,实现网络监控需要选择合适的工具。本文介绍了网络流量监控、入侵检测与防御、日志分析、网络性能监控等方面的常用工具,希望能为您的网络监控工作提供参考。在实际应用中,您可以根据自身需求选择合适的工具,并结合多种工具的优势,构建一个完善的网络监控体系。

猜你喜欢:云网监控平台